Como corrigir erro em pacotes ou pacotes quebrados no Ubuntu, Debian, Linux Mint

Como corrigir erro em pacotes ou pacotes quebrados no Ubuntu, Debian, Linux Mint

Não é tão comum dar erro em pacotes ou pacotes quebrados no Ubuntu, Debian ou qualquer sistema que use o .deb. Mas, ao mesmo tempo, percebemos que algumas pessoas estão tendo problema com quebra de pacotes, especialmente após atualizar o Ubuntu para a versão mais recente ou até mesmo o Debian.

Comumente recebemos relatos que na hora da instalação ou atualização do pacote, o gerenciador travou ou bloqueou e aí o pacote quebrou. Hoje você verá como corrigir pacotes quebrados no Ubuntu e Debian, a ideia desta dica é fornecer uma solução e não analisar o motivo de quebra de pacote.

Para corrigir a quebra de pacote tanto no Debian, quanto no Ubuntu, vamos utilizar apenas o terminal e alguns comandos, você verá alguns modelos de comandos.

Corrigindo pacotes quebrados no Ubuntu, Debian ou Linux Mint

Se você lembra o nome do pacote quebrado, execute o comando abaixo, troque o item “nome-do-pacote-quebrado” pelo pacote com problema:

Bashsudo dpkg --remove -force --force-remove-reinstreq NOME-DO-PACOTE-QUEBRADO

Agora, se você estava instalando um grande número de pacotes ou não sabe o nome, execute um dos comandos abaixo que eles devem corrigir o pacote quebrado:

Bashsudo apt-get --fix-broken install

Outra forma de corrigir a quebra de pacotes:

Bashsudo apt-get clean Bashsudo apt-get install -f Bashsudo dpkg --configure -a Bashsudo apt-get update

Caso tenha tido problemas com travamento do gerenciador de pacotes, execute o comando abaixo:

Bashsudo rm /var/lib/apt/lists/* -vf Bashsudo apt-get update

Será que foi um conflito que causou o problema? Então execute o comando abaixo:

Bashsudo apt-get clean Bashsudo apt-get autoclean Bashsudo apt-get autoremove

E se foi alguma dependência que quebrou, faltou ou corrompeu, execute o comando abaixo:

Bashsudo dpkg --configure -a Bashsudo apt-get update